1. How much does it cost to employ an injury attorney?

Most personal injury lawyers work on a contingency cost basis, indicating they just make money if you win your case. Their fees usually vary from 25% to 40% of the settled amount.

2. For how long do I need to submit a claim after an accident?

The statute of restrictions varies by state however normally ranges from one to 3 years. It's crucial to talk to an attorney immediately to guarantee your claim is filed on time.

3. What if I am partially at fault for the accident?

Numerous states follow a relative negligence rule. This means that you can still recuperate damages even if you are partly at fault, however your compensation may be reduced by your portion of fault.

4. Will my case go to trial?

A lot of personal injury cases settle out of court. Nevertheless, if negotiations fail, an attorney can get ready for trial and supporter for your rights in front of a judge or jury.

5. What damages can I claim?

You might be entitled to various damages, consisting of medical costs, lost wages, pain and suffering, psychological distress, and property damage.
